Peach was rescued off of the Red List from Bakersfield Humane Society. She was found as a stray walking the streets asking for help from human passers by. Although we don't know who her parents were, she looks like a petite white Shepard with a splash of husky. She is energetic and curious. Would do best in an active home that would take Peach on adventures. She loves to wrestle with her dog friends preferable medium-large dog friends. She has learned to enjoy her crate and will go in with no fuss. She enjoys dog puzzles and any and all toys. She does require to be crated during car rides as she is still working on her potty training. But when she is able to she loves the breeze against her face while she sticks her head out the window. She will make an amazing companion to anyone who is ready to give her the love, attention, and training for her to thrive in any home.
